Colwill Confident in Outperforming Higher League Teams

Rubin Colwill is optimistic that Cardiff City will secure a victory against Wrexham in the EFL Cup. This match, set for Tuesday at Stok Cae Ras, marks the teams’ first encounter in over two decades.

Recent Successes Fuel Confidence

Cardiff’s recent win over Premier League team Burnley, with a scoreline of 2-1, has significantly boosted the team’s morale. Brothers Rubin and Joel Colwill, alongside teammate Callum Robinson, played pivotal roles in this upset, leading to heightened expectations for their next challenge.

Team Performance and Standings

  • Cardiff City is currently at the top of League One.
  • They are tied on points with Stevenage and Bradford City.
  • Cardiff suffered their third league loss this season to Bolton, but spirits remain high.

Excitement for the Upcoming Match

The matchup against Wrexham is seen as a significant rivalry. Colwill noted that the extra emphasis comes from Wrexham being in a higher division. This adds intensity to their meeting, often referred to as a semi-derby due to the limited number of Welsh clubs in the English football system.

Wrexham’s Journey

Colwill expressed admiration for Wrexham’s recent accomplishments, acknowledging their positive impact on Welsh football. However, he reassured Cardiff supporters that these accolades will not affect their preparation or mindset going into the game.

Looking Ahead

Cardiff City is focused on advancing to the quarter-finals of the EFL Cup. As they prepare for this all-Welsh clash, Colwill and his teammates are eager to capitalize on their recent successes and the confident momentum established after their victory over Burnley.
